CHERRY HILL, N.J., May 08, 2024--According to the results of the 2024 Small Business Survey, released today by TD Bank, America’s Most Convenient Bank®, a large majority of small business owners (SBOs) have a positive outlook on the future of their business. 90% of the SBOs surveyed noted their optimism for the future of their business in the next 12 months, which is up from 80% in 2023, indicating a light at the end of the tunnel following prolonged turbulence in the economic environment.

TD Auto Finance Canada (TDAF) is proud to be named #1 in Dealer Satisfaction among Non-Captive Lenders with Prime and Non-Prime Retail Credit in the J.D. Power 2024 Canada Dealer Financing Satisfaction Study. Announced today, TDAF won two 2024 Dealer Satisfaction segments, achieving its seventh consecutive J.D. Power award in the non-captive non-prime segment.
